London's Lost Graveyard: Crossrail Discovery



Crossrail is a 73-mile railway line under construction in London and its environs. One of its main features is its 26 miles of new tunnels, which are being carved out under the capital using giant tunnelling machines. Ten new world-class stations for the 21st century are also being constructed. It is Europe's largest construction project and is due to open in 2019. But the construction work has uncovered a 300-year-old graveyard that reveals intriguing new information about the people who built London, as this fascinating documentary reveals.

The Sky at Night


Bitterly cold: The New Horizons probe has revealed mountains made of ice on Pluto. The temperature on Pluto is around -369F at its warmest

The BBC's late night, monthly The Sky at Night takes at look at Pluto in what is a landmark episode for the long-running show.

Maggie Aderin-Pocock and Chris Lintott present the inside story of NASA's groundbreaking visit to Pluto. This is the first time any probe has visited the dwarf planet and Sky at Night has ringside seats, bringing you the entire story and expert insight into the latest images from the New Horizons probe. Sky at Night celebrates its 750th episode with the most exciting space event of 2015.

Joanna Lumley's Trans-Siberian Adventure

Episode 2


The huge statue of Genghis Khan, who founded the mighty Mongol Empire, the second-largest empire in history after the British Empire


The actress and former model reaches the midway point of her 6,000-mile journey from Hong Kong to Moscow via the Trans-Siberian Railway, taking in the varied sights of Mongolia, a vast, empty land six times the size of the UK but with just 3 million people. She spends time with native nomads, and visits a giant statue of Genghis Khan, as well as a gold mine. She also heads to the nation's capital, Ulan Bator, where she tracks down the famous Mongolian throat-singers, before catching a train bound for mighty Russia, the largest nation on Earth. However, making a start on the Siberian leg of her trek proves more difficult than Joanna expects when she experiences a spot of bother at the border. But then it's off to meet some ballroom dancing enthusiasts... in the unlikely setting of the Siberian city of Irkutsk.

I watched The Human Centipede 2 last night. Could it be the sickest and most depraved film ever made?





Martin is a mentally disturbed loner who lives with his nagging mother on a bleak London council estate, where loud neighbours and squalid living conditions threaten to plunge this victim of sexual and psychological abuse over the edge. Working the night shift as an attendant at an underground car park, he indulges his obsession with The Human Centipede (First Sequence) watching the film over and over on a laptop in his office and meticulously examining the scrapbook he has lovingly filled with memorabilia from the film, including the ***-to-mouth surgery instructions made famous by Dr. Heiter, the mad scientist from Martin's favourite film. Pushed to the brink by his belligerent mother and haunted by the teasing voices of his abusive and imprisoned father, Martin sets into motion his plan to emulate Heiter's centipede by creating his own version. In a rented warehouse, he begins to acquire victims, including his loud, violent neighbour, a prostitute and her lecherous client, and several more: including Martin's piece de resistance, one of the actresses from The Human Centipede (First Sequence). Although lacking the medical skills of his hero, Martin soldiers on with grotesque DIY gusto, armed with a healthy supply of duct tape, household tools and staple guns! What follows is one of the most harrowing and terrifying films ever conceived, featuring a central character that makes Dr. Heiter seem tame in comparison. The Human Centipede 2 (Full Sequence) is a triumph in biological body-horror by Tom Six, one of the new masters of the horror genre.

It was originally banned in the United Kingdom by the BBFC because of its "revolting" content but was eventually granted an 18 certificate after over 30 cuts were made. The film was also banned in Australia for a short period of time. It is banned in New Zealand.

Life of a Mountain: A Year on Scafell Pike



A beautifully cinematic documentary following a year in the life of England's highest mountain, Scafell Pike, through the eyes of the farmers who work the valleys and fells, those who climb the mountain for pleasure and those who try to protect its slopes.

Filmed over a twelve-month period, it follows the seasons on the mountain from spring lambs through to winter snows. The contributions of the British Mountaineering Council and National Trust volunteers make clear the crucial importance of maintaining the landscape quality of England's highest peak for future generations.

All Aboard! The Canal Trip




A two-hour, real-time canal boat journey down one of Britain's most historic waterways, the Kennet and Avon Canal, from Top Lock in Bath to the Dundas Aqueduct. Using an uninterrupted single shot, the film is a rich and absorbing antidote to the frenetic pace and white noise of modern life.

Taking in the images and sounds of the British countryside, underpinned by the natural soundscape of water lapping, surrounding birdsong and the noise of the chugging engine, this is a chance to spot wildlife and glimpse life on the towpath while being lulled by the comforting rhythm of a bygone era.

Along the journey, graphics and archive stills embedded into the passing landscape deliver salient facts about the canal and its social history.

Rugby League


Challenge Cup Semi-Final: Leeds Rhinos v St Helens




Mark Chapman introduces live coverage of an historic and heavyweight semi-final showdown between Challenge Cup holders Leeds Rhinos and reigning Super League champions St Helens. The two clubs, who currently sit first and second respectively in Super League, have contested some epic matches in recent years, including four Grand Finals, while the Rhinos defeated Saints in the fifth round of the cup en route to lifting the trophy last summer.

Leeds ended a run of six straight final defeats with their 2014 success, while 12-time winners Saints are contesting their first semi-final in four years. Another memorable encounter is in store at the Halliwell Jones Stadium in Warrington, which hosts the first Challenge Cup semi-final to be televised live on a Friday night.

The winners will face either Warrington Wolves or Hull Kingston Rovers, who play in today's other semi-final, in the final at Wembley Stadium on 29th August.
